Hydraulic Module Inspection
HYDRAULIC MODULE INSPECTIONCAUTION: Turn the ignition switch off before connecting or disconnecting the Hi-Scan.
1. Jack the vehicle up and support the vehicle with rigid racks at the specified jack-up points or replace the wheels which are checked on the rollers of the braking force tester.
CAUTION:
1. The roller of the braking force tester and the tire should be dry during testing.
2. When testing the front brakes, apply the parking brake, and when testing the rear brakes, stop the front wheels by chocking them.
2. Release the parking brake and feel the drag force (drag torque) on each road wheel.
When using the braking force tester, take a reading of the brake drag force.
3. Turn the ignition key "OFF" and set the Hi-Scan or Hi-Scan Pro as shown in the diagram.
